Gavin Chavez and McKenna Guevara show off their scholarships alongside Calhoun County Go-Texan District Chair Molly Brown. The two students attended the Houston Livestock Show and Rodeo Scholarship program and received their scholarships for their exceptional efforts in both Calhoun County Go-Texan and 4-H organizations.
